/sbin/on_ac_power is in powermgmt-base, so I'm reassigning this bug over
there.

Of course the easiest and fastest case is to build the modules in the
kernel; that's the case in jaunty but doesn't help hardy nor custom
kernels.

On my system, the aforementioned modules are loaded automatically during
boot even when not specified in /etc/default/acpid, so it's probably
just a race that on_ac_power needs the modules loaded.  I think
on_ac_power could be improved to test for ACPI support and modprobe the
relevant modules if the information is not present yet (just like we
load modules to find the rootfs).
